class TabInfo {
constructor() {
this._url = undefined;
this._allowedFirstPartyDomains = new Map();
this._allowedThirdPartyDomains = new Map();
this._blockedFirstPartyDomains = new Map();
this._blockedThirdPartyDomains = new Map();
this._created = Date.now(); //When this tabInfo was created; used for filtering 'other' cookies set by code
this._updated = Date.now(); //When this tabInfo last had some cookie or domain info updated.
this._browserActionIcon = undefined;
}
static fromObject(obj) {
var result = new TabInfo();
result._url = obj._url;
result._allowedFirstPartyDomains = obj._allowedFirstPartyDomains;
result._allowedThirdPartyDomains = obj._allowedThirdPartyDomains;
result._blockedFirstPartyDomains = obj._blockedFirstPartyDomains;
result._blockedThirdPartyDomains = obj._blockedThirdPartyDomains;
result._created = obj._created;
result._updated = obj._updated;
result._browserActionIcon = obj._browserActionIcon;
//Don't worry about the 'has*' properties; we don't use them in the popup
return result;
}
get allowedFirstPartyDomains() {
return this._allowedFirstPartyDomains;
}
get allowedThirdPartyDomains() {
return this._allowedThirdPartyDomains;
}
get blockedFirstPartyDomains() {
return this._blockedFirstPartyDomains;
}
get blockedThirdPartyDomains() {
return this._blockedThirdPartyDomains;
}
get created() {
return this._created;
}
get updated() {
return this._updated
}
get browserActionIcon() {
return this._browserActionIcon;
}
set browserActionIcon(value) {
this._browserActionIcon = value;
}
// Registers that a cookie with domain `cookieDomain` was set or blocked
// because of configuration for `configDomain`. For blocked we
// expect cookieDomain == configDomain (although don't enforce or require this)
// Stores it against the frameId, so 2 levels of nested maps.
// Why not create a proper class + data structure? Because we need to pass
// this data from background to popup, thus serialise it, and doing so is a
// royal PITA (see "fromObject" above for just this class). Maps and Sets
// 'Just Work'
// Data structure is a top level Map, keys being frame id.
// For each frameid, it is a map; the keys are the configDomains (the domains
// that were in the configuration that allowed/blocked the cookie) and the
// values are *Set* objects; the set values are the actual domains of the
// cookies that were allowed/blocked.
_registerCookie(store, cookieDomain, configDomain, frameId) {
var frameData = store.get(frameId)
if(!frameData) {
frameData = new Map();
store.set(frameId, frameData);
}
var cd = frameData.get(configDomain);
if(!cd) {
cd = new Set();
frameData.set(configDomain, cd);
}
cd.add(cookieDomain);
}
registerAllowedFirstPartyCookie(cookieDomain, configDomain, frameId) {
this._registerCookie(this._allowedFirstPartyDomains, cookieDomain, configDomain, frameId);
}
registerAllowedThirdPartyCookie(cookieDomain, configDomain, frameId) {
this._registerCookie(this._allowedThirdPartyDomains, cookieDomain, configDomain, frameId);
}
// When blocked, the domain which caused the blocking is the cookie domain
// (there was no domain listed in configuration that caused it to be blocked)
registerBlockedFirstPartyCookie(cookieDomain, frameId) {
this._registerCookie(this._blockedFirstPartyDomains, cookieDomain, cookieDomain, frameId);
}
registerBlockedThirdPartyCookie(cookieDomain, frameId) {
this._registerCookie(this._blockedThirdPartyDomains, cookieDomain, cookieDomain, frameId);
}
markUpdated() {
this._updated = Date.now();
}
}
